WebCan root bound plants recover? Yes, root bound plants can recover. A root bound plant is a plant whose roots have become so large that the root system is no longer able to absorb enough water and nutrients from the soil. Root bound plants often experience stunted growth and eventually die if not corrected. Root bound plants occur when the roots of a plant have grown to restrict … phillies record 2019WebJun 13, 2024 · Aroids like ZZ plants can survive being slightly root bound because they can survive drought conditions. The plant prefers to be underwatered and slightly starved as the rhizomes are able to sustain the plant for quite a while.
